Frequently Asked Questions about Belmont

What type of rentals are currently available in Belmont?

There are currently 2475 Apartments for Rent in Belmont, PA with pricing that ranges from $500 to $12,427. There are also 571 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Belmont ranging from $650 to $6,600.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Belmont?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Belmont ranges from $650 to $6,600 with an average monthly rent of $2,751.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Belmont?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Belmont range from $944 to $10,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$950 to $6,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,050 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$999.
